hey gang,
i dunno how many of you have heard of this before, but it is the biggest annual f-body show anywhere. they have car show, drag racing, road racing, and autocross for 3 days straight.
i was wondering how many of you may be interested in taking teh trip down for a little bit of fun.
it takes place may5-7 at memphis motorsports park. check it out http://www.fbody-event.org
